861 Process all Uefi Shell 2.0 command line options.
863 see Uefi Shell 2.0 section 3.2 for full details.
865 the command line must resemble the following:
867 shell.efi [ShellOpt-options] [options] [file-name [file-name-options]]
869 ShellOpt-options Options which control the initialization behavior of the shell.
870 These options are read from the EFI global variable "ShellOpt"
871 and are processed before options or file-name.
873 options Options which control the initialization behavior of the shell.
875 file-name The name of a UEFI shell application or script to be executed
876 after initialization is complete. By default, if file-name is
877 specified, then -nostartup is implied. Scripts are not supported
880 file-name-options The command-line options that are passed to file-name when it
883 This will initialize the ShellInfoObject.ShellInitSettings global variable.
885 @retval EFI_SUCCESS The variable is initialized.
